Understanding the Different Types of Sachet Films Available

When choosing sachet films for packaging, it's essential to understand the different types available. There are many options, each with unique properties and uses. For instance, laminating films provide a strong barrier against moisture and air. They are often used for products that need longer shelf life. These films can be made from various materials, such as polyester or polyethylene.

Another popular type is biodegradable films. They cater to environmentally conscious brands. These films break down more quickly than traditional plastics. However, their durability under different storage conditions can be a concern. They may not protect contents as effectively as other materials.

You might also consider heat-sealable films. They are handy for high-speed packaging processes. However, they require specific sealing equipment. Open-pouch sachets are less common but offer ease of use and accessibility. Selecting the right type of sachet film involves balancing sustainability with practicality. The ideal choice will depend on your product's storage needs and your brand values.

Evaluating Material Properties for Optimal Product Protection

When considering sachet films, material properties play a crucial role in ensuring optimal product protection. Various materials, such as polyethylene and polypropylene, exhibit different barrier properties. For instance, polyethylene offers excellent moisture barrier capabilities, which are vital for food preservation. Reports indicate that sachets made with high-density polyethylene (HDPE) can reduce oxygen transmission rates by up to 85% compared to traditional films. This significant reduction helps maintain product freshness.

Moreover, the choice of thickness impacts the overall integrity of the sachet. A study revealed that increasing film thickness by just 10 microns can enhance puncture resistance by nearly 30%. This is essential for protecting fragile items during shipping and handling. However, selecting thicker films may lead to higher costs and increased waste. Hence, striking a balance between durability and sustainability is a challenge that many packaging professionals face.

Another aspect to consider is the transparency of the material. While clear films showcase products effectively, they may not always provide adequate protection against UV light. Reports suggest that sachets with UV-blocking properties can reduce the degradation of sensitive ingredients by over 60%. This highlights the need for careful evaluation of transparency against product requirements. Making informed decisions based on material properties will lead to more effective packaging solutions.

Assessing Barrier Properties for Moisture, Oxygen, and Light Protection

Selecting the right sachet film for packaging can be challenging. One of the most crucial factors is assessing barrier properties. These properties protect your product from moisture, oxygen, and light, which can affect quality and shelf life.

Moisture barrier is particularly vital for perishable goods. High moisture levels can lead to spoilage. Therefore, choosing a film that effectively keeps out humidity is essential. Look for films that have been tested for water vapor transmission rates. Lower rates indicate better protection against moisture.

Oxygen and light are equally important. Exposure to oxygen can cause oxidation, leading to rancidity. Light can degrade sensitive products, especially in the food and cosmetics industries. Select films with strong oxygen barrier properties. Films with UV-blocking capabilities can provide additional protection against light degradation. It’s important to research and understand these properties thoroughly before making a choice. Balancing these factors can be complex and might require some trial and error.

Considering Cost-Effectiveness and Sustainability in Film Selection

Selecting the right sachet film for packaging requires careful assessment of cost-effectiveness and sustainability. The packaging industry is witnessing a shift toward eco-friendly materials. According to a report by Smithers Pira, 45% of consumers prefer products with sustainable packaging. This trend emphasizes the importance of aligning cost with environmental impact.

When evaluating sachet films, consider materials that offer both functionality and environmental benefits. Biodegradable films, for example, can be more expensive upfront. Still, they can reduce long-term waste management costs. The global market for biodegradable films is projected to reach $6.4 billion by 2025, reflecting growing consumer demand.

Tip: Always perform a life cycle analysis to ensure that the material you choose minimizes environmental impact over its entire life span.

Finding a balance between price and sustainability can be challenging. Some low-cost options may not provide adequate protection or shelf life. A study indicates that improper material selection can lead to increased spoilage rates, impacting overall profit margins. The right film must ensure product integrity while being cost-effective.

Tip: Invest in small-scale testing before mass production to prevent waste and refine your packaging strategy.

Identifying Industry Standards and Compliance Requirements for Packaging

When choosing the right sachet film for packaging, understanding industry standards is essential. Many sectors, like food and pharmaceuticals, require strict compliance with regulations. In the U.S., the FDA oversees food packaging to ensure safety. Non-compliance can lead to costly recalls. Companies should also consider ISO certifications for quality assurance.

Different materials meet varied compliance needs. For instance, polyethylene offers moisture barriers while adhering to food safety regulations. ASTM International sets standards for plastic materials in packaging. Studies show that 70% of brands prioritize regulatory compliance in their packaging strategies. However, many companies struggle to keep up with new regulations, creating risks.

Environmental impact is another crucial factor. The push for sustainability is strong. According to a 2022 survey, 65% of consumers prefer eco-friendly packaging. Companies risk losing market share if they ignore this demand. Balancing compliance with environmental impact is challenging yet necessary. Brands must stay informed and agile in adapting their packaging strategies.

Film Type Material Thickness (microns) Barrier Properties Compliance Standards
Standard Sachet Film PET/PE 60 Oxygen: 5 cc/m²/day FDA, ISO 22000
High Barrier Film NY/AL/PE 75 Oxygen: 1 cc/m²/day FDA, EU 10/2011
Biodegradable Film PLA 50 Oxygen: 10 cc/m²/day OK Compost, ASTM D6400
Metalized Film PET/AL 70 Oxygen: 0.1 cc/m²/day FDA, BRC Packaging
